Aylanny
ay-LAN-ee
Aylanny is a girl’s name of English origin, meaning “Modern invented name blending 'Ayla' and 'Annie' perhaps representing light and grace”. It currently ranks #15576 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2023.

The Story of Aylanny
Picture a name that sparkles with the grace of a falling star and the warm glow of the sun, a celestial blend for your little one.
Aylanny is a modern invention, a lyrical fusion that seems to combine the light of 'Ayla', which can mean 'moonlight' or 'oak tree', with the classic charm of 'Annie'. It is a name born of light and grace.
